Confidential Job Menu

This menu allows you to print or delete print jobs stored in the
printer's Hard Disk Drive using the Confidential Job feature of
the printer driver's Reserve Job function. You need to enter the
correct password to access this data. For instructions on using this
menu, see "Using the Confidential Job Menu" on page 342.

Reset Menu

This menu allows you to cancel printing and reset the printer
settings.
Clear Warning
Clears the last warning message that appear on the LCD panel.
Clear All Warnings
Clears all warning messages that appeared on the LCD panel and
are still stored in the printer's memory.
Reset
Stops printing and clears the current job received from the active
interface. You may want to reset the printer when there is a
problem with the print job itself and the printer cannot print
successfully.
Reset All
Stops printing, clears the printer memory, and restores the printer
settings to their default values. The print jobs received from all
interfaces are erased.
Note:
Performing Reset All clears print jobs received from all interfaces. Be
careful not to interrupt someone else's job.
